✓ CT/W February 24th, 1936 Dear Mr. Hamlin: I regret to tell you that I find it will be impossible to have the exhibition of African art at Buffalo, as the owners tell me that they do not wish to arrange for any other exhibitions for the time being. I am sorry to be unable to give you better news, but I can assure you I did my utmost in the matter. In the meanwhile, with my kindest regards, Believe me to be, Yours sincerely, (Clyfford Trevor) Chauncey J. Hamlin, Esq., Museum of Modern Sciences Buffalo, New York
